Freeway to Memory Level Parallelism in Slice-Out-of-Order Cores

Rakesh Kumar, Mehdi Alipour, David Black-Schaffer

Exploiting memory level parallelism (MLP) is crucial to hide long memory and last level cache access latencies. While out-of-order (OoO) cores, and techniques building on them, are…

Page Tables: Keeping them Flat and Hot (Cached)

Chang Hyun Park, Ilias Vougioukas, Andreas Sandberg +1

As memory capacity has outstripped TLB coverage, large data applications suffer from frequent page table walks. We investigate two complementary techniques for addressing this cost…
